There are 2 major kinds of skylights offered for purchase and installment: curb-mounted and deck-mounted. Suppress mounted requires a box framework for the system to set upon.

Deck placed skylights are a much more current layout, and have a lower profile since there's no box structure underneath. These hug the roof and are thought about a more power reliable option as a result of this. Unlike other normal windows, skylights catch light from above, making spaces brighter throughout the day. They are typically made from glass or plastic, can be found in various forms and sizes, and assist with lights, air flow, and give a great sight of the skies. To enhance energy efficiency, attributes like special finishings and protected glass can help maintain the room comfortable.

Glass skylights, being bad here insulators, add to warm loss during Buffalo's winters months, causing higher heating bills. Energy-efficient versions with low-E coverings, double or triple glazing, and sufficient insulation decrease warm transfer. Correct installment with efficient sealing protects against air leaks. Inappropriate setup of skylights raises the risk of leaks, possibly triggering water damages, spots, and mold growth.


Typically, the optimal skylight incline is your geographical latitude plus 5-15 levels. In Buffalo (latitude 42 levels), the optimal skylight slope is 47-57 levels.

Some kinds of skylights can open up, allowing fresh air to move in and stagnant air to drain. This natural ventilation helps enhance the air high quality inside your home, getting rid of odors and decreasing moisture build-up (Rooflights). This is particularly useful in bathroom and kitchens where the air can end up being loaded with vapor or smoke
